What they do

A Human Resources Generalist provides overall operational support in a human resources department, including supporting employee relations, onboarding, benefits and leave management of a company or organization.

Job Description

Adler Pelzer Group - a growing global Tier 1 supplier of Acoustic and Thermal Soft Trim products to the automotive industry is seeking for a strong and motivated individual to fill the position of HR Generalist at the Manufacturing Facility in Thomson, GA. Located just outside of Augusta and minutes from Fort Gordon. The HR Generalist administers all activities relating to the management of Human Resources, from hire to termination, including but not limited to benefits, training and development, recruiting, and employment law. Responsibilities of the HR Generalist include: Oversee the interview and hiring process including resume review, screening, and interview scheduling and checking references and completing orientation. Oversee and administer employee termination processes adhering to State and Federal employment laws. Manage HRIS for assigned locations and create and manage active and inactive personnel files within the guidance of employment law and best practices. Timely reporting of Payroll information to central payroll for hourly and salary. Administer and implement corporate wide Human Resource Administration instructions, protocols, and practices, integral in recommending updates and reviews based on changing laws and circumstances. Ensures implementation and administration of Corporate Human Resource Policy and Procedures. Requirements for the HR Generalist include: Minimum of an Associate's Degree in Business Administration, Human Resources or related field or the equivalent in work experience and education.
